openssl_x509_fingerprint(3) php man page | unix.com

Man Page: openssl_x509_fingerprint

Operating Environment: php

Section: 3

OPENSSL_X509_FINGERPRINT(3)						 1					       OPENSSL_X509_FINGERPRINT(3)

openssl_x509_fingerprint - Calculates the fingerprint, or digest, of a given X.509 certificate

SYNOPSIS
bool openssl_x509_fingerprint FALSE (mixed $x509, [string $hash_algorithm = "sha1"], [bool $raw_output])
DESCRIPTION
openssl_x509_fingerprint(3) returns the digest of $x509 as a string.
PARAMETERS
o $x509 - See Key/Certificate parameters for a list of valid values. o $hash_algorithm - The hash algorithm to use, e.g. "md5" or "sha1" o $raw_output - When set to TRUE, outputs raw binary data. FALSE outputs lowercase hexits.
RETURN VALUES
Returns a string containing the calculated certificate fingerprint as lowercase hexits unless $raw_output is set to TRUE in which case the raw binary representation of the message digest is returned. Returns FALSE on failure. PHP Documentation Group OPENSSL_X509_FINGERPRINT(3)
Related Man Pages
bbdigest(1) - debian
hash_hmac(3) - php
hash_hmac_file(3) - php
md5_file(3) - php
digest::bubblebabble(3pm) - debian
Similar Topics in the Unix Linux Community
Simple rules of the UNIX.COM forums:
Rules for Homework & Coursework Questions Forum
Coming Soon: Upgrade Forum Software (Dec 31 - Jan 1)
The Order of the Wizard's Hat - Lifetime Achievement Award 2019 - Congrats to Don Cragun
The Order of the Wizard's Hat - Lifetime Achievement Award 2019 - Congrats to Wolf Machowitsch